Harrogate, TN -- Lincoln Memorial baseball is set to celebrate its senior class this Saturday as the Railsplitters host Wingate for Senior Day. The program will pause to honor seven student-athletes who have dedicated their time and effort to the blue and gray, recognizing their contributions to the team and the university community. Each senior will be joined on the field by family and friends to commemorate their collegiate careers before the conference match up begins.
The ceremony will begin with Kevin Fernandez, who will be escorted by his father, Rene Fernandez, and his girlfriend, Haley Suarez. Following him is Ford Hallock, who will be joined on the diamond by his parents, Sarah and Mark Hallock. The Railsplitters will also recognize Alex Kowalski as he walks out with his father, Chris Kowalski, his mother, Maryanne Kowalski, and his sisters, Haylee and Lyla Kowalski.
The recognition continues with Dylan Maire, who will be accompanied by his mother, Tracy Maire, his father, Christophe Maire, and his grandparents, Barbara and Kevin Kavanaugh. Lucas Smith will take the field alongside his parents, Laurie and Danny Smith, and his sister, Sophie Smith. Brady Morse will be escorted by his mother, Tamme Morse, his father, Paul Morse, his sister, Jaycee Morse, and his girlfriend, Madalyn Moffett. Rounding out the senior class is Eli Edds, who will be joined by his parents who are also former Railsplitters, Carrie and John Edds, and his siblings/sibling-teammate, Colby, McKenzie, and Ty Edds.
